Re: Why it is sometimes hard to be a student on CD.

From my experiences I don’t think it is particularly hard to be a student on CD, you just need to realise where you are capable of contributing to the discussion effectively and the areas in which you might not be able to.

For me I find I am confident in lots of the technical discussions, about part use, how to make this work etc. But I refrain from some discussions. I find it is really important that if you are going to post something about a contentious issue or something that could be taken differently to how you intended it that you need to be careful. I often type up my posts in MS Word, and will make 2 or 3 revisions before I am comfortable to post it. Even then I might send the post to one of my team mates, to have a read through and check or a mentor if I feel that it is necessary. I made a bad decision in the past, not on CD but in an email. It is very easy to write something you don’t want too, when you are tired, stressed or feel like something has really upset you. It is extremely easy to click send, before realising that you shouldn’t have sent it. I find that it is best to type it up, then maybe leave it until the next morning or a few hours and have a read over it. Maybe someone else might have expressed your view point in a better way, or maybe you’ll realise that it isn’t the best thing to send or post.
